Clinique for Men to use digital agency

by Noel Bussey Campaign 01-Feb-08

Estee Lauder is looking for a digital agency to handle online advertising for its Clinique range of lotions and fragrances.

The winning agency will be briefed initially with relaunching the
company's Clinique for Men range.

The work will involve redesigning the brand's website and online
advertising, as well as developing a strategy to target men more

effectively.

The men's range of cosmetics falls within three main product categories:
skincare, shaving and grooming. These include facial soaps and liquid
face washes, a range of "Scruffing Lotions" of varying strength, an eye
hydrator and lip balm.

The move follows last month's announcement by Estee Lauder that it had
kick-started a review of its £200 million global media duties with
a view to consolidating the brief into one network.

The company is considering three agencies for the pitch: WPP's Maxus,
the US incumbent; Havas' MPG, a non-roster agency; and Omnicom's M2M,
which handles the UK market for Estee Lauder.

In 2007, Estee Lauder's net sales exceeded £3.5 billion, up 9 per
cent on 2006.
